Picking the Right Paint and Devices



Wondering which repaint and tools are best for your indoor painting job? When it concerns picking the right paint, consider factors like the kind of surface you're repainting, the desired coating, and the shade alternatives offered. For wall surfaces, a latex paint is frequently the very best selection because of its resilience, very easy clean-up, and fast drying out time. If you're painting a high-traffic area like a hallway or cooking area, a semi-gloss or satin surface might be preferable as they're easier to cleanse.



When it comes to tools, buying high-quality brushes and rollers can make a substantial distinction in the final end result of your paint job. Search for brushes with dense bristles that appropriate for the kind of paint you're utilizing. Roller covers been available in various nap sizes, with shorter naps being perfect for smooth surface areas like walls and ceilings, while longer naps are much better for textured surface areas.

Preparing Your Space for Painting



To make sure an effective interior paint job, proper preparation of your area is important. Start by eliminating furnishings from the room or relocate to the facility and covering it with plastic sheets. Next off, take down any kind of decorations, change plates, and outlet covers. Usage painter's tape to safeguard baseboards, trim, and any kind of locations you do not want to repaint. Fill up holes and fractures in the wall surfaces with spackling compound, after that sand them smooth when completely dry. Dirt and clean the walls to make certain correct paint bond.

After preparing the walls, put down ground cloth to protect your floorings. If you're repainting the ceiling, cover the whole flooring location with drop cloths, securing them in position with painter's tape. Make sure correct ventilation by opening up home windows or making use of fans to help with drying and to reduce the fumes. Finally, collect all your painting products in one place to have every little thing you need accessible. Putting in the time to prepare your area will certainly make the paint process smoother and assist you achieve a professional surface.

Performing the Paint Process



Begin by selecting the proper paint color and coating for the area you're repainting. Consider the state of mind you wish to produce and just how all-natural light impacts the shade throughout the day. Once you have your paint, collect high-quality brushes, rollers, painter's tape, and ground cloth. Before beginning, make certain the wall surfaces are tidy and completely dry.

Begin by cutting in the edges of the walls and around trim with a brush. After that, utilize a roller to cover larger areas, working in little areas. Remember to keep a wet edge to avoid noticeable lap marks. Apply a second layer for an expert surface, if required.

When painting doors and trim, make use of a smaller brush for accuracy. Work carefully, using thin, even coats. Get rid of the painter's tape while the paint is still somewhat wet to stop peeling.

Enable the paint to completely dry totally before moving furniture back into place. Take your time and take note of information for a flawless finish that will certainly change the appearance of your space.
